About Yi Man

Yi Man is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ering, Renewable Energy, Sustainability and the Environment, Mechanical Engineering and Molecular Biology, having authored 39 papers that have together received 997 indexed citations. Recurring topics across this work include Geothermal Energy Systems and Applications (10 papers), Cooperative Communication and Network Coding (7 papers), IPv6, Mobility, Handover, Networks, Security (7 papers), Soil and Unsaturated Flow (4 papers), Mobile Ad Hoc Networks (4 papers), Climate change and permafrost (4 papers), Advanced Wireless Network Optimization (3 papers) and Robot Manipulation and Learning (3 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(796 citations), Civil and Structural Engineering (405 citations), Environmental Engineering (207 citations), Building and Construction (186 citations) and Atmospheric Science (226 citations). Yi Man has collaborated with scholars based in China, Hong Kong and United States. Frequent co-authors include Hongxing Yang, Zhaohong Fang, Nairen Diao, Ping Cui, Junhong Liu, Xin Li, Jinggang Wang, Jeffrey D. Spitler, Lin Lu and Yunfeng Wu. Their work appears in journals such as Applied Energy, IEEE Transactions on Instrumentation and Measurement, Chinese Journal of Chemistry, International Journal of Heat and Mass Transfer and International Journal of Low-Carbon Technologies.
